WebThe Heptameron is a collection of 72 short stories written in French by Marguerite de Navarre, sister of François I, and published posthumously in 1558, almost a decade after her death. It was originally designed to be a collection of 100 tales told over 10 days in the tradition of Giovanni Boccaccio’s The Decameron. WebStory. There once was a guy named Puccio, who was part of the Franciscan order. He took the title "Friar" even though he didn't live in a cloister. In fact, he was married to the young and beautiful Monna Isabetta. She wasn't too happy about Friar Puccio's ideas about sexual abstinence. Whenever she felt "playful," Puccio would talk about Jesus ...
